abstract = {Combined computational–experimental analyses explain and
quantify the spermine-vectorized F14512's boosted potency as
a topoII poison. We found that an optimized polyamine moiety
boosts drug binding to the topoII/DNA cleavage complex,
rather than to the DNA alone. These results provide new
structural bases and key reference data for designing new
human topoII poisons.},
